Is there a such thing as too clean of a tank? My snails keep dying off, is it because I don’t feed very often? I broadcast feed once a week (25gal tank) and every 3 days I drop about 8 pellets in for my 2 clowns. Is there just not enough waste to keep the snails fed and alive? I started with 4 snails, they all died off within a couple months, so I added 6 more and they died off within about 3mo.

Post by: dbowman on April 15, 2020, 14:54:32
a cuc needs waste or algae to survive. so yes if the tank is sterile they will die.
